First Annual Kershaw County Read-In

High school student reads to kids

Friday, October 23rd, marked the first annual Kershaw County Read-In. Over 800 elementary, middle school and high school students attended the event hosted by Camden High at its football stadium.   Highlights of the events included read-alouds by CHS mentor tutors, teacher cadets, student-athletes, cheerleaders and drama class.  Members of the drama class performed a dramatic reading of the book "The Day the Crayons Quit" by Drew Daywalt in their crayon costumes.  The Camden High Bulldog mascot, Champ, entertained the children throughout the day.
